YOU SAID:
I found the best house ever to live in.
INTO JAPANESE
住む最高の家を見つけました。
BACK INTO ENGLISH
I found the best home.
INTO JAPANESE
最高の家を見つけた。
BACK INTO ENGLISH
Finding the best home.
INTO JAPANESE
最高の家を見つけること。
BACK INTO ENGLISH
Finding the best home.
Well done, yes, well done!